Searched refs:nrf_csr_read (Results 1 – 5 of 5) sorted by relevance
370 return nrf_csr_read(VPRCSR_MSTATUS) & VPRCSR_MSTATUS_MIE_Msk; in nrf_vpr_csr_machine_interrupts_check()382 return nrf_csr_read(VPRCSR_MTVT); in nrf_vpr_csr_machine_trap_vector_table_addr_get()387 return nrf_csr_read(VPRCSR_MEPC); in nrf_vpr_csr_machine_exception_pc_get()392 return (nrf_vpr_csr_trap_cause_t)((nrf_csr_read(VPRCSR_MCAUSE) in nrf_vpr_csr_machine_trap_cause_code_get()399 … return (nrf_csr_read(VPRCSR_MCAUSE) & VPRCSR_MCAUSE_INTERRUPT_Msk) >> VPRCSR_MCAUSE_INTERRUPT_Pos; in nrf_vpr_csr_machine_trap_interrupt_check()404 return nrf_csr_read(VPRCSR_MTVAL); in nrf_vpr_csr_machine_trap_value_get()414 return (nrf_csr_read(VPRCSR_MINTTHRESH) & VPRCSR_MINTTHRESH_TH_Msk) >> VPRCSR_MINTTHRESH_TH_Pos; in nrf_vpr_csr_machine_interrupt_threshold_get()419 uint32_t reg = nrf_csr_read(VPRCSR_MCOUNTINHIBIT); in nrf_vpr_csr_machine_cycle_counter_enable_set()430 uint32_t reg = nrf_csr_read(VPRCSR_MCOUNTINHIBIT); in nrf_vpr_csr_machine_cycle_counter_enable_check()437 return nrf_csr_read(VPRCSR_MCYCLE) | ((uint64_t)nrf_csr_read(VPRCSR_MCYCLEH) << 32); in nrf_vpr_csr_machine_cycle_counter_get()[all …]
664 return (uint16_t)nrf_csr_read(VPRCSR_NORDIC_DIR); in nrf_vpr_csr_vio_dir_get()684 return (uint16_t)nrf_csr_read(VPRCSR_NORDIC_DIRB); in nrf_vpr_csr_vio_dir_buffered_get()704 return ((nrf_csr_read(VPRCSR_NORDIC_DIRBS) & VPRCSR_NORDIC_DIRBS_DIRTYBIT_Msk) in nrf_vpr_csr_vio_dir_buffered_dirty_check()720 return (uint16_t)nrf_csr_read(VPRCSR_NORDIC_IN); in nrf_vpr_csr_vio_in_get()725 return nrf_csr_read(VPRCSR_NORDIC_INB); in nrf_vpr_csr_vio_in_buffered_get()730 return nrf_csr_read(VPRCSR_NORDIC_INBRB); in nrf_vpr_csr_vio_in_buffered_reversed_byte_get()735 return nrf_csr_read(VPRCSR_NORDIC_INMODE); in nrf_vpr_csr_vio_mode_in_get()745 return nrf_csr_read(VPRCSR_NORDIC_INMODEB); in nrf_vpr_csr_vio_mode_in_buffered_get()755 return (uint16_t)nrf_csr_read(VPRCSR_NORDIC_OUT); in nrf_vpr_csr_vio_out_get()775 return nrf_csr_read(VPRCSR_NORDIC_OUTB); in nrf_vpr_csr_vio_out_buffered_get()[all …]
199 return nrf_csr_read(VPRCSR_NORDIC_CNTMODE0); in nrf_vpr_cst_vtim_count_mode_get()201 return nrf_csr_read(VPRCSR_NORDIC_CNTMODE1); in nrf_vpr_cst_vtim_count_mode_get()230 return (uint16_t)nrf_csr_read(VPRCSR_NORDIC_CNT0); in nrf_vpr_csr_vtim_simple_counter_get()232 return (uint16_t)nrf_csr_read(VPRCSR_NORDIC_CNT1); in nrf_vpr_csr_vtim_simple_counter_get()260 return (nrf_csr_read(VPRCSR_NORDIC_CNTTOP) & VPRCSR_NORDIC_CNTTOP_CNT0RELOAD_Msk) in nrf_vpr_csr_vtim_simple_counter_top_get()263 return (nrf_csr_read(VPRCSR_NORDIC_CNTTOP) & VPRCSR_NORDIC_CNTTOP_CNT1RELOAD_Msk) in nrf_vpr_csr_vtim_simple_counter_top_get()277 reg = nrf_csr_read(VPRCSR_NORDIC_CNTTOP); in nrf_vpr_csr_vtim_simple_counter_top_set()283 reg = nrf_csr_read(VPRCSR_NORDIC_CNTTOP); in nrf_vpr_csr_vtim_simple_counter_top_set()336 return nrf_csr_read(VPRCSR_NORDIC_CNT); in nrf_vpr_csr_vtim_combined_counter_get()346 return nrf_csr_read(VPRCSR_NORDIC_CNTTOP); in nrf_vpr_csr_vtim_combined_counter_top_get()
165 return nrf_csr_read(VPRCSR_NORDIC_TASKS); in nrf_vpr_csr_vevif_tasks_get()180 return nrf_csr_read(VPRCSR_NORDIC_EVENTS); in nrf_vpr_csr_vevif_events_get()200 return ((nrf_csr_read(VPRCSR_NORDIC_EVENTSBS) & VPRCSR_NORDIC_EVENTSBS_DIRTYBIT_Msk) in nrf_vpr_csr_vevif_events_buffered_dirty_check()206 return nrf_csr_read(VPRCSR_NORDIC_SUBSCRIBE); in nrf_vpr_csr_vevif_subscribe_get()216 return nrf_csr_read(VPRCSR_NORDIC_PUBLISH); in nrf_vpr_csr_vevif_publish_get()236 return nrf_csr_read(VPRCSR_NORDIC_INTEN) & mask; in nrf_vpr_csr_vevif_int_enable_check()
241 #define nrf_csr_read(csr) \ macro295 #define csr_read nrf_csr_read